Some information on Public Transport

Public transport in Vienna is very well developed and one of the good things about the city. One of the cheapest possibilities is buying an "8-day-pass" which costs ATS 300,- (around 20 US dollars), so this is around ATS 38,- per day (around 2 US dollars 50 cents). The pass is also called "Unweltstreifenticket" or "green ticket", as its colour is green. It is a multi-ride ticket consisting of 8 stripes. You simply validate one of the stripes the first time you use public transport on a day by stamping the stripe e.g. in the tram or bus. The ticket is valid for the whole day of validation.

In addition there are also weekly passes (price around ATS 155,-), monthly passes (price around ATS 560,-) or yearly passes (price around ATS 5200,-). Students can obtain a "semester ticket" (valid from october to january or from march to june) for ATS 2120,-
